Unprecedented case of murder is registered in Yucatan

The tranquility of Chicxulub Puerto was brutally shattered by one of the most atrocious acts in recent memory.

Linda Louise Johnston, a 71-year-old retired United States Air Force veteran, was found dismembered and headless, in a case that has already been described as unprecedented barbarity in Yucatán.

The mutilated body was found near the nightclub district of Chicxulub, a spot frequented by tourists and locals alike, now the scene of a bloody nightmare.

Authorities, between silence and uncertainty, barely confirm the obvious: the horror is real and close at hand.

And everything seems to indicate that the murderer is her own son.
Damon Anthony Martinez, an ex-convict with a dark past and a history of drugs and violence in his country, is named as the prime suspect, according to unofficial leaks. Along with another alleged accomplice, he allegedly brutally took her mother’s life.

The victim had already expressed her fear of dying at his hands. Her last messages to her niece were heartbreaking: “I’m scared, I’m hiding.” Linda wrote on social networks just a couple of days ago.

“This foreigner who should never have entered the country!” Screamed neighbors and friends, who had already warned about the erratic and violent behavior of Linda’s son.

A neighbor recounted that days before the crime, the same man had savagely beaten Linda without anyone intervening in time.
